The Ultimate Guide to Traveling Cases: Protecting Your Belongings on the Go:

Whether you’re traveling for business or pleasure, having the right traveling case can make all the difference in the world. From suitcases to backpacks to duffel bags, there are countless options to choose from, each with their own unique features and benefits. In this guide, we’ll explore the different types of Traveling Cases available, and help you choose the perfect one to protect your belongings on the go.

Choosing the Right Material:

The first step in selecting the perfect traveling case is deciding what material you want it to be made from. Hardshell suitcases are durable and offer excellent protection for fragile items, but they can be heavy and cumbersome to transport. Softshell suitcases, on the other hand, are lightweight and easy to maneuver, but may not provide as much protection for your belongings. Other popular materials include leather, canvas, and nylon, each with their own advantages and disadvantages.

Size Matters:

Once you’ve decided on a material, it’s time to think about size. The size of your traveling case will depend on a number of factors, including the length of your trip, the amount of items you need to bring, and the mode of transportation you’ll be using. For longer trips or those with multiple destinations, a larger suitcase may be necessary, while a smaller backpack or duffel bag may be more appropriate for shorter trips or day excursions.

Organizational Features:

Organization is key when it comes to traveling, and the right traveling case can make all the difference in keeping your belongings in order. Look for suitcases with multiple compartments, pockets, and dividers to keep your items separated and easy to find. Backpacks and duffel bags should also have enough pockets and compartments to keep your essentials organized and easily accessible.

Mobility and Comfort:

Finally, it’s important to consider how easily your traveling case can be transported, as well as how comfortable it is to carry. Suitcases with wheels and telescoping handles are easy to maneuver through airports and other transportation hubs, while backpacks and duffel bags with padded straps and back panels can help reduce strain on your shoulders and back.

Specialized Traveling Cases:

In addition to traditional suitcases, backpacks, and duffel bags, there are also specialized traveling cases designed for specific purposes. For example, garment bags are designed to transport suits, dresses, and other formal wear without wrinkling or damaging them. Camera bags are designed to protect delicate photography equipment during transit, while laptop bags provide padded compartments to keep your computer safe and secure.

Eco-Friendly Options:

For travelers who are environmentally conscious, there are also eco-friendly traveling cases available. These can be made from recycled materials, or designed to minimize waste and reduce environmental impact. Some companies even offer carbon-neutral shipping options to offset the environmental impact of shipping their products.

Choosing the Right Brand:

When it comes to choosing a traveling case, the brand you choose can make a big difference in terms of quality, durability, and customer service. Some of the most popular and well-respected brands include Samsonite, Tumi, and Rimowa, which are known for their high-quality materials, innovative features, and attention to detail.

Care and Maintenance:

Once you’ve chosen the perfect traveling case, it’s important to take good care of it to ensure it lasts for years to come. This may include cleaning it regularly, storing it in a dry and cool place when not in use, and repairing any damage as soon as possible to prevent further wear and tear.
